How much debt is “enough” for bankruptcy? There is no magic number. 💳

There is no single dollar amount that automatically makes bankruptcy appropriate. The real question is whether the debt has become unmanageable and is affecting basic financial stability. If balances keep growing despite payments, you’re borrowing to cover basic bills, or creditors are suing, your debt may already be unmanageable.

Bankruptcy is a legal tool, not a personal failure. Getting advice can help you understand your options and regain control. 🌱

Can you file Chapter 7 if you have a good job? Yes, being employed does not automatically disqualify you. 💼

A steady paycheck can still disappear into credit cards, personal loans, and minimum payments. Income matters, but so do your household size, expenses, assets, debts, and complete financial picture.

: What are the different types of bankruptcy?

Bankruptcy is not one-size-fits-all. The type you file depends on your income, debt level, and financial goals.

The most common types include:
📉 Chapter 7: Typically involves liquidation of non-exempt assets to discharge qualifying debt
📊 Chapter 13: Focuses on a structured repayment plan over time
🏢 Other chapters may apply to businesses or specialized financial situations
⚖️ Eligibility requirements differ based on income and debt type
